The booming culture of London sound systems

A new exhibition looks at the history of London's thriving Jamaican sound system culture, that has been going for over 50 years. Music historian, John Masouri was involved with the project. He describes how the London scene, which started as a rebellion against racial discrimination, became a global phenomenon. (Photo: Man poses infront of soundsystem Credit: David Hoffman)
